Today, 13th January 2020, Bogi is being celebrated across Tamil Nadu is known to us.

For the safety of the public, GCC has mentioned certain rules that must be followed compulsorily today on the occasion of bhogi festival. It is clear that those persons who burn old tyres etc today would be fined an amount of Rs 1000. The Pongal celebrations have begun in TN amidst the Coronavirus restrictions. It is known that the last day of the month of Margazhi is being celebrated as Bogi festival day. On this day, people would burn old things present in their houses. Districts near the Andhra Pradesh border usually celebrate bhogi very well.

The GCC has announced that in Chennai city plastic items and tyres should not be burnt for celebrating this bhogi festival. All the 15 zones belonging to GCC have been asked to follow this without fail. It must not be forgotten that even in the past this rule was announced by the GCC.
